On Wed, 16 Apr 2003, Derek Madsen wrote: > When the tcstart file is run manually or called by shorewall I get a > bunch of errors saying: RTNETLINK answers: No such file or directory OR > RTNETLINK answers: Invalid argument > I believe that traffic shaping is modularized in the Bering kernels. To run the HTB version of Wonder Shaper on RedHat, the following modules are loaded: sch_ingress cls_32 sch_htb I would assume that on Bering you will have to manually load those modules. -Tom -- Tom Eastep \ Shorewall - iptables made easy Shoreline, \ http://www.shorewall.net Washington USA \ te...@sh... |
